MCC Theater's Ride the Cyclone extends to 29 December

MCC Theater's New York premiere of Ride the Cyclone - only the third musical in the company's 30-year history - has extended its limited off-Broadway engagement. The production is scheduled to officially open tonight at the Lucille Lortel Theatre, following previews from 9 November, and will now run through to 29 December 2016 (instead of 18 December).

Ride the Cyclone features book, music & lyrics by Jacob Richmond & Brooke Maxwell, and is directed by Rachel Rockwell. Musical supervision is by Doug Peck, with musical direction by Remy Kurs.

Synopsis: "The Saint Cassian High School Chamber Choir will board the Cyclone roller coaster at 8:17pm. At 8:19 the front axle will break, sending them to their tragic demise. A mechanical fortune teller invites each to tell the story of a life interrupted - with the promise of a prize like no other. Ride the Cyclone is a wildly original new musical - part comedy, part tragedy, and wholly unexpected."

The full cast of Ride the Cyclone now includes (in alphabetical order) Lillian Castillo (Constance), Gus Halper (Misha), Karl Hamilton (Karnak), Emily Rohm (Jane Doe), Tiffany Tatreau (Ocean), Kholby Wardell (Noel) and Alex Wyse (Ricky).

The creative team behind Ride the Cyclone features scenic design by Scott Davis, costume design by Theresa Ham, lighting design by Greg Hofmann, sound design by Garth Helm, and projection design by Mike Tutaj.
